1What is the average cost for professional carpet cleaning in Princeton, Idaho, and what factors influence the price?

In the Princeton and broader North Idaho region, the average cost for professional carpet cleaning typically ranges from $0.25 to $0.50 per square foot, with most jobs averaging $150-$300 for a standard home. Key factors affecting price include the carpet's soil level (heavily soiled carpets from local dirt and winter mud cost more), the cleaning method required (e.g., hot water extraction for deep cleaning), and any necessary pre-treatment for specific stains like pine sap or red clay common to the area. Always request an in-home or detailed virtual estimate for the most accurate pricing.

2Considering Princeton's climate, are there specific seasonal recommendations for scheduling carpet cleaning?

Yes, Princeton's distinct four-season climate, with wet springs, dusty summers, and snowy winters, makes late spring and early fall ideal times for carpet cleaning. Scheduling in May/June or September/October allows carpets to dry thoroughly with moderate humidity and open windows, avoiding the deep winter chill where drying can be slow and tracked-in snowmelt is heavy. This timing also helps remove allergens like pollen or mold spores that can accumulate seasonally.

3Are there any local Idaho or Latah County regulations that carpet cleaning companies in Princeton must follow?

While there are no Princeton-specific carpet cleaning ordinances, all Idaho service providers must adhere to state regulations regarding proper wastewater disposal. Reputable local companies will never dump chemical-laden wastewater into storm drains or septic systems not designed for it; they must use a dedicated utility sink or approved disposal method. Additionally, they should be licensed and insured to operate in Idaho, which protects homeowners from liability.

4How should I choose a reliable carpet cleaning service in a smaller community like Princeton?

In a smaller community, word-of-mouth and verified local reputation are paramount. Ask neighbors for referrals and check for companies with strong, long-standing presence in the Princeton/Potlatch or broader Latah County area. Ensure they are certified by a recognized body like the IICRC, which trains technicians on proper procedures for different carpet types. Always ask for proof of insurance and detailed explanations of their cleaning process and guarantees.

5We have well water and a septic system, which are common in rural Princeton. Are there special considerations for carpet cleaning?

Absolutely. It's crucial to inform your cleaning company about your well and septic system. They should use cleaning solutions that are septic-safe, biodegradable, and free of harsh chemicals that could disrupt your septic tank's bacterial balance or contaminate your well water. Furthermore, professional truck-mounted or portable extraction units recover most of the water, minimizing the volume of moisture released into your home's environment and reducing strain on your septic system.
